At the moment, although the country has vigorously advocated, and various companies are ready to move, it is not easy for electric vehicles to enter the homes of ordinary people in a short period of time. National policies can provide (car purchase compensation, road trips, etc.), while electric vehicle charging station networks cannot be built in a short period of time. The main reason is that fast charging of electric vehicles requires instantaneous powerful power and electricity, which cannot be met by conventional power grids. A dedicated charging network must be built. This involves the transformation of the entire State Grid. The transformation of the State Grid is not a trivial matter, and it costs a lot of money. From discussion, project establishment to network formation, it cannot be achieved overnight.


The solution that can better solve the problem of fast charging is-changing the station-using the method of replacing the battery of the car to replace the long charging process. A car needs to be equipped with two batteries. When one battery is used up, it will automatically switch to the other. At this time, you can go to the swap station to replace the used battery and install a fully charged battery. The replaced batteries are uniformly charged and maintained by the power station, provided that the charging station has a considerable number of spare batteries. The advantage of this method is that it is fast, and the user can get on the road after changing the battery, which is faster than refueling. With this method coupled with auxiliary methods such as parking lot charging piles, I believe that the popularity of electric vehicles is just around the corner.

fast charging

① The scale of a typical fast charging station

According to the data on fast charging of electric vehicles, a charging station is generally configured to charge 8 electric vehicles at the same time.

② Typical configuration of power supply for charging station

a Plan, design of the construction of the distribution station: 2 10KV cable inlets (with 3*70mm cables), 2 500KVA transformers, 10 380V outlets (with 4*120mm cables, 50M long, 10 circuits).

b. Design 2 10KV cables (with 3*70mm cables), set up 2 500KVA user box transformers, each box transformer with 4 380V outlets, for charging stations (with 4*120mm cables, 50M long, 8 circuits )
